Excerpt from How to Harvest Ice Three quarters of a century spans the commercial development of the natural ice industry. Once an article of luxury and used in small quantities it is now one of the most important of every day necessities. In its annual harvest and distribution it requires an investment of millions of dollars and the services of hundreds of thousands of men. Extending over that entire period we have been affiliated with the iceman in all parts of the country. In no small degree his hardship and failures, as well as his prosperity, have been shared by us. With such a common interest between us, co-operation has naturally resulted and where improved tools and apparatus could be used to advantage we have always worked toward increasing the productiveness of his labor. On account of this familiarity with the methods employed in different parts of the country we each year receive many letters asking for advice. Some of these inquires, as may be expected, are from those unacquainted with the ice business. To furnish the information desired in full and yet concise form, this pamphlet was first issued over thirty years ago. The present enlarged edition indicates some of the many improvements which have taken place during that time. Excerpt from Combination Ice and Electric Plants Artifical ice or mechanically made ice dates back to an early period, but only in comparatively recent years have meth ods of manufacture been developed sufficiently to make an in dustry of manufacturing ice. Now, nearly all towns in the South whose population is past the thousand mark have an ice factory. The southern towns are notable in this respect in as much as natural ice can not be harvested there, but many localiti=s having natural ice als support a well paying arti ficial ice plant. This shows the 107 cost of artificial ice which falls below the cost of harvesting natural ice in many instances. Mechanical poxer is of course required to manu facture ice. Excerpt from The Fisheries and Fishery Industries of the United States It is now nearly four hundred years Since these grounds were first fished upon by Europeans, and their resources are still unfailing; but the fishing interests have been mainly transferred to the New World, France alone of European countries having continued to send fishing vessels across the Atlantic down to 1880. Since then, however, the Portuguese have begun to exhibit some activity in connection with the cod fishery of the Grand Bank, and in the Spring and sum mer of 1885 bought several New England fishing schooners and fitted out others from home ports.
